    I haven't leveled a lock from 60-70 since it was relevent content, but, to the best of my estimation, there is not a lot of change in the leveling power of the specs.

    Affliction is the theortical fastest, being able to dot a bunch of mobs and just keep going. Can be fragile. Lends itself to a skilled player really trying to min/max the leveling experience.

    Demonology not only wins in safety, but also extreme soloing. If you want to take out things over your level or elite quests while solo, demonology is easily the strongest. It's quick enough, but slower over all then affliction.

    Destruction... yeah... I don't know. Talk to a destuctionist. Historically, it burned individual mobs quickly, but suffered downtimes and in the end worked out to take longer then affliction in total. That says nothing about how satisfying it may be. If you like to burn stuff quick and then sit, hell, it might be your paradise.

    Hi hix, im actualy in the same position as you, i ding'd 67 yesterday and have been switching between all 3 spec's since level 40
    here's what i've noticed about all 3 (by the way im in no way an expert with WL's i just started one a few days ago)

    Demo: best spec for dungons i'm normaly top dps even with others 1 level higher than me the AoE is just so good, on bosses (single target) its good dps nothing to complain about, for questing i just dot and move on we can take the hit from a few mobs while we wait for them to die plus (burst) HoG and soulburn soulFire will kill any mob

    Aff: In dungons the AoE is ok try to Dot any trash or even a boss up and it dies too quick for you to get any dps out of it i can see where it would be good in FL on 6-10min bosses but while leveling and bosses dieing in <30sec it doesnt do much, questing much the same as Demo dot up move on but no real burst like demo has

    Destro: again AoE is fine not as good as demo but no bad either, before you get through your inital start up rotation (bane, soulburn/soulFire immolate, conflagrate, crouption ) the boss is dead again nothing to complain about but nothing great either. Questing i found this alot more single target killing as opposded to the multi dot and move on from the other specs

    As you may have guessed from that i'd recommend demo in dungons what ever spec you have will make little difference to how fast you get through thats more up to your group but for soloing questing i think it has the edge

    but hay i could be playing completely wrong here lol this is just from my experiance over the past few days and being around the same level you are hope it helps

    I'd suggest you go Demo.

    It's very very strong in dungeon trash and decent on bosses. Stuff dies so fast at that level-range that it's honestly not worth it to go Affliction.
    For questing it's pretty much Send Pet -> HoG -> Immolate -> Corruption -> Target next mob, DoTs will finnish off whatever is left on the 1st mob.
    Whenever Felstorm is up just multipull with Corruption and once the mobs get to you Felstorm + Hellfire and they die withing seconds.

    I lvld my Warlock pretty recently. I tried both Destro and Demo at 60-70 and found out Demo was the best. Though Destro is quite viable as well. Theres not that much manaproblems and you pretty much own stuff in 2-3 globals.
